Behold a phantasmagoria of miracles at Company XIV’s variety show of intoxicating illusions. Cocktail Magique is a marvelous party nestled in Graffiti Alley in the heart of trendy Bushwick, Brooklyn. Over the course of the show a dapper magician invokes a legion of luminescent libations while burlesque stars pour immersive cocktails from a curated menu at the speakeasy bar. The extravaganza features mind-blowing magic tricks, mesmerizing chanteuses, victorian circus acts and lavish design—all spritzed with the gallant wit and joie de vivre of the Belle Epoque. Enter our secret world of cocktail conjuration.

Accessibility

  • Curb Ramps

    There is a curb cut in front of the venue.
  • Entrance

    Ground floor entrance with a slight ramp. No stairs.
  • Parking

    There is street parking in the neighborhood.
  • Restroom

    ADA restrooms on the ground floor.
  • Seating

    Ground floor seating. Row A: plush chairs; Row B: Magique Luxe couches for two people; Tables C - H: bar height chairs.
  • Water Fountain

    Filtered water dispenser available for all guests.
  • Wheelchair Info

    Wheelchair seating is subject to availability. Email reservations@companyxiv.com for assistance.
